Honey Vanilla Grilled Sweet Potatoes
Transform ordinary sweet potatoes into a summery sensation! Thinly sliced and kissed with the warmth of cinnamon, the richness of honey, and the delicate aroma of vanilla, these grilled sweet potatoes are a delightful side dish that's both simple and sophisticated.

Preheat your grill to medium heat (around 350°F or 175°C). (5 minutes)

In a 9x13-inch aluminum foil pan, arrange the sliced sweet potatoes in a single layer. Ensure they are not overcrowded for even cooking. (2 minutes)

In a small bowl, whisk together the melted butter and ground cinnamon until well combined. Drizzle this mixture evenly over the sweet potatoes in the pan. Cover the pan tightly with aluminum foil. (3 minutes)

Place the covered pan on the preheated grill. Grill, stirring gently every 5 minutes to prevent sticking and ensure even cooking, for a total of 15 minutes. (15 minutes)

In a separate small bowl, whisk together the honey and vanilla extract until smooth. Remove the aluminum foil from the sweet potato pan and drizzle the honey-vanilla mixture evenly over the potatoes. (2 minutes)

Return the aluminum foil to cover the pan. Continue grilling for another 10 minutes, or until the sweet potatoes are tender and easily pierced with a fork. Stir once more halfway through cooking. (10 minutes)

Carefully remove the pan from the grill. Let the sweet potatoes rest for a few minutes before serving. Garnish with a sprinkle of extra cinnamon or a drizzle of honey, if desired.
For a smoky flavor, add a pinch of smoked paprika to the butter-cinnamon mixture.
If you don't have a grill, you can bake the sweet potatoes in a preheated oven at 375°F (190°C) for about 25-30 minutes, or until tender.
Feel free to adjust the amount of honey and cinnamon to your liking.
For a vegan option, substitute the butter with melted coconut oil or vegan butter alternative.
